




I recently spent a week testing the Divoom B-Beetle to see if its aesthetic appeal matches its audio performance. This pint-sized speaker claims to blend vintage charm with modern connectivity, and I put its Bluetooth 5.1 stability and FM radio features to the test.
The build quality of the Divoom B-Beetle is impressive, featuring a durable yet lightweight chassis that weighs only 103g. Its retro aesthetic is executed well with vibrant color options, and the hardware feels sturdy enough to survive being tossed into a bag regularly.
Setting up the Bluetooth connection was seamless, and the speaker maintained a reliable link during my morning walks. I particularly enjoyed the flexibility of the TF card slot, which allowed me to listen to my favorite playlists without needing my phone nearby.
This speaker is ideal for style-conscious listeners who want a cute, highly portable device that can handle both wireless streaming and standalone FM radio.
